Stanley "Stan" Barta

Stanley “Stan” Barta, 77, of Iowa City, passed away peacefully on January 7, 2026.  A Celebration of Life will be held on January 17, 2026, from 11:00 – 1:00 p.m. at Sts. Peter and Paul Chapel in Solon.

Stan was born and raised in Solon, Iowa on his parents’ century farm.  Stan married his wife, Jackie Maher, on November 9, 1968, and had 2 sons, Chad and Cory, and later a granddaughter, Emma.

Stan worked as an electrician for IBEW Local 405, where he was a 54 year member.  He also worked for Wears Auctioneering for 25+ years, this was a job he loved and enjoyed all the people, atmosphere, and most of all collecting antiques with his wife, Jackie.

Stan loved the outdoors, his yard, and the Hawkeyes.  In his younger years, he enjoyed fishing, hunting, and finding elusive mushrooms.  In his later years, you could find them in his neighbors’ driveways gathering to socialize or solving the world’s problems.  

He was preceded in death by his parents, Virgil and Lily; wife, Jackie; 2 sisters-in-law, Joyce and Rosemary, and a brother-in-law, Jerry.  

Stan is survived by his sons, Chad and Cory (Tammy); his siblings, Allen (Sharlye), Richard, Jeff (Judi), Nancy (Bob), and Linda; his cherished granddaughter, Emma.  Also surviving are many nieces and nephews; and special friend and traveling partner, Bonnie Pitz.

Memorial donations may be directed to Sts. Peter and Paul Chapel in Solon.
